UNITED STATES.

NEW LOAN TO BRITAIN

(Times Service.)

NEW YORK. Oct. 24. A new American loan to the British Government will shortly be annoxinced. It may exceed fifty millions sterling. .The New York Times gives prominence- to a correspondent's suggestion that America and other nations draw up" a plan for the purpose of internment in neutral countries of all prisoners of war, thus relieving the belligerents of war prisoners, who total 2£ millions. \
